//
// Validator
// Copyright © 2025 Space Code. All rights reserved.
//
@testable import ValidatorCore
import XCTest
final class DependentValidationRuleTests: XCTestCase {
// MARK: - Mock Validation Rules
struct AlwaysPassRule<T>: IValidationRule {
let error: IValidationError = "Should not fail"
func validate(input _: T) -> Bool { true }
}
struct AlwaysFailRule<T>: IValidationRule {
let error: IValidationError = "Failed"
func validate(input _: T) -> Bool { false }
}
// MARK: - Tests
func test_dependentValidationRuleUsesCorrectValidationBasedOnDependentValue() {
// given
let country = "US"
let rule = DependentValidationRule<String, String>(
dependsOn: country,
error: "Invalid",
ruleProvider: { value in
if value == "US" {
AlwaysPassRule<String>()
} else {
AlwaysFailRule<String>()
}
}
)
// when
let isValid = rule.validate(input: "12345")
// then
XCTAssertTrue(isValid)
}
func test_dependentValidationRuleSwitchesBehaviorWhenDependentValueChanges() {
// given
var country = "US"
let rule = DependentValidationRule(
dependsOn: country,
error: "Invalid",
ruleProvider: { value in
if value == "US" {
AlwaysPassRule<String>()
} else {
AlwaysFailRule<String>()
}
}
)
// then
XCTAssertTrue(rule.validate(input: "value"))
country = "FR"
XCTAssertFalse(rule.validate(input: "value"))
}
func test_validationFails_whenInnerRuleFails() {
// given
let rule = DependentValidationRule(
dependsOn: "ANY",
error: "Invalid",
ruleProvider: { _ in AlwaysFailRule<String>() }
)
// when
let result = rule.validate(input: "test")
// then
XCTAssertFalse(result)
}
func test_validationPasses_whenInnerRulePasses() {
// given
let rule = DependentValidationRule(
dependsOn: "ANY",
error: "Invalid",
ruleProvider: { _ in AlwaysPassRule<String>() }
)
// when
let result = rule.validate(input: "test")
// then
XCTAssertTrue(result)
}
func test_canWorkWithDifferentInputTypes() {
// given
let rule = DependentValidationRule(
dependsOn: true,
error: "Invalid",
ruleProvider: { condition in
if condition {
AlwaysPassRule<Int>()
} else {
AlwaysFailRule<Int>()
}
}
)
// then
XCTAssertTrue(rule.validate(input: 123))
}
}
